Output 28aa3b8ad21dbc9b37c884f7da430bc7629f018491e142a7667694b360fe0731:0

value
9622545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ca31a153f8d32587c8bbddb640bcb3cc0263e35 OP_EQUAL
address
35m33W5ASjHHYf4vrWfVGoVQL7Zx8XEGPP
transaction
28aa3b8ad21dbc9b37c884f7da430bc7629f018491e142a7667694b360fe0731
confirmations
300498
spent
true